There are discs of cartilage between the bones in the vertebral column because the cartilage discs throughout the spine have three main roles:

  • They function as shock absorbers throughout the spine, arranged between each skeletal vertebra.
  • They function as hard ligaments that retain the skeletal vertebra of the backbone together.
  • They are cartilaginous joints that permit subtle mobility in the backbone.
